There is an external resistor divider on PB16, acting like a pull-down 
(R22+R23). PB16 reset state is input, pull-up, schmitt trigger, you need 
to disable the pull-up in pinctrl this way:

usb1: gadget@f803c000 {
        pinctrl-names = "default";
        p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_board_usb1>;
        …
}

pinctrl … {
        usb1 {
                pinctrl_board_usb1: usb1-board {
                        atmel,pins = <AT91_PIOB 16 AT91_PERIPH_GPIO 
AT91_PINCTRL_DEGLITCH>;    /* PB16, no pull up and deglitch */
                };
        };
};
